About Chang-Sheng Lin
Chang-Sheng Lin is a scholar working on Ecological Modeling, Management Science and Operations Research and Statistics, Probability and Uncertainty, having authored 49 papers that have together received 1.3k indexed citations. Recurring topics across this work include Multi-Criteria Decision Making (11 papers), Structural Health Monitoring Techniques (10 papers) and Structural Engineering and Vibration Analysis (5 papers). The work is most often cited by research in Management Science and Operations Research (629 citations), Management of Technology and Innovation (87 citations) and Ecological Modeling (50 citations). Chang-Sheng Lin has collaborated with scholars based in China, Taiwan and Saudi Arabia. Frequent co-authors include Gang Kou, Daji Ergu, Yang Chen, Fawaz E. Alsaadi, Yi Peng, Weiming Wang, Liang Xu, Yi Liao, Guangxu Li and Shaoxian Song. Their work appears in journals such as Scientific Reports, The Journal of Physical Chemistry C and European Journal of Operational Research.
